Inventory Export Scripts
EPICenter Concepts and Solutions Guide
243
Table 12 specifies the options you can use with these commands:
NOTE
The inv.bat, inv.sh, slot.bat, and slot.sh scripts retrieve information only from an EPICenter server that runs on the
same machine as the scripts.
Inventory Export Examples
The following examples illustrate the usage of these commands.
To export slot information to the file slotinventory.csv from the EPICenter database whose login
is “admin123” and password is “sesame” under Windows, enter the following command:
slots.bat -u admin123 -p sesame -o slotinventory.csv
Under Linux or Solaris, enter the following command:
slots.sh -u admin123 -p sesame -o slotinventory.csv
This will not prompt for a password, and will output the results to the specified file.
To export device information to the console, after prompting for a password under Windows, enter
the following command:
inv.bat
Under Linux or Solaris, enter the following command:
inv.sh
This command will login with the default user name (admin), will prompt for the password, and
will output the results to the console.
To export device information to the console, using the default login and default password under
Windows, enter the following command:
inv.bat -d -o output.csv
Under Linux or Solaris, enter the following command:
inv.sh -d -o output.csv
Table 12: Inventory script command options
Option Value Default
-d None
If present, the command will use the default EPICenter
password (“”) and will not prompt for a password.
If -p option not present, prompts for
password
-n EPICenter server port number 8080
-o Name of file to receive output. If you don’t specify a path,
the file will be placed in the current directory
(user\scripts\bin).
output written to console (stdout)
-p EPICenter user password “”
-u EPICenter user name admin
-s For the msinv.bat and msinv.sh commands only: Name
(and path) of file containing EPICenter server list
<epc_install_dir>\user\scripts\
config\servers.txt under Windows,
<epc_install_dir>/user/scripts/
config/servrs.txt under Linux or Solaris
